Balthus — Dessins (Drawings)
Balthus

Dessins (Drawings)

Balthus's 'Dessins' is an artist's proof set of 15 featuring drawings, co-published by two Parisian editions. The work represents Balthus's approach to figure drawing and representational art in print form.

Medium
All signed and numbered 'EA 9/15' in pencil (an artist's proof set, the edition was 150), further numbered in pencil on the colophon, co-published by Éditions de la Tempête and Éditions Enrico Navarra, Paris, all unframed.
